In the morning, visit the scenic Abbey Falls which is surrounded by coffee plantations and spice estates. Take a short hike to reach the waterfall and witness the water cascading down from a height of 70 feet. Afternoon could be spent visiting the nearby Madikeri Fort and Omkareshwara Temple, a shrine dedicated to Lord Shiva which features a unique blend of architectural styles. In the evening, head to Raja's Seat, a garden with fountains and beautiful sunset views.
Spend the morning at Dubare Elephant Camp, where you can learn about and interact with the gentle giants. Take a coracle ride on the Kaveri river and watch the elephants bathe and play in the water. Afternoon could be spent visiting the nearby Nisargadhama Island, a scenic picnic spot surrounded by thick foliage and bamboo groves. In the evening, visit the Namdroling Monastery, the largest teaching center of the Nyingma lineage of Tibetan Buddhism in the world.
Start the day early and drive to Talakaveri, the origin of the Cauvery River. Witness the confluence of three rivers and enjoy the scenic views of the surrounding hills. Afternoon could be spent visiting the nearby Bhagamandala Temple, a pilgrimage site known for its confluence of three rivers.
